The Solar Revolution Needs Better Tools

Ever wondered why solar panels still struggle in cloudy conditions? The answer lies in an 80-year-old problem: standard silicon cells waste up to 35% of available light. Enter poly-crystalline black silicon solar cells

The black silicon approach attacks all three simultaneously. By etching the surface with plasma or chemical treatments, manufacturers create a fractal-like landscape that:

  1. Reduces reflection to below 2%
  2. Captures infrared wavelengths standard cells ignore
  3. Maintains 90% output at 60°C

    But here''s the rub: current poly-crystalline black silicon production adds $0.08/W to manufacturing costs. While panel prices have dropped 89% since 2010, buyers remain hypersensitive to upfront costs. The industry''s playing a dangerous game of "efficiency chicken" - how much premium will consumers swallow for better performance?

    California''s recent decision to mandate solar + storage for new homes creates an interesting test case. If installers can demonstrate 20% faster payback periods using black silicon tech, we might see a domino effect across North America. But that''s a big "if" in markets where $50 difference can sway purchase decisions.

    Q&A: Quick Answers to Burning Questions

    Q: How does black silicon handle snow buildup?A: The textured surface actually sheds snow 30% faster than smooth panels - a game-changer for Canadian installations.

    Q: Can existing solar farms retrofit this technology?A: Unfortunately no. The cell structure modifications require full panel replacement, though some companies are exploring spray-on nano-coatings.

    Q: What''s holding back mass adoption?A: It''s mainly about manufacturing scale. Current global production capacity meets only 7% of annual demand, but Chinese factories are racing to close the gap.
